2. Ingredients for Lemon Chicken with Rich Lemon Butter Sauce

  • 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• Salt and freshly ground black pepper, to taste
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1/4 cup fresh lemon juice (about 2 lemons)
  • 1/2 cup chicken broth
  • 1/4 cup heavy cream
  • 4 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 1 teaspoon lemon zest
  •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)

3. Step-by-Step Instructions for Making Lemon Butter Chicken

Preparing the Chicken

Season the chicken breasts generously with salt and pepper. Heat the ol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the chicken and cook for about 6-7 minutes on each side, or until golden brown and cooked through. Remove the chicken from the skillet and keep warm.

Making the Lemon Butter Sauce

In the same skillet, add the minced garlic and sauté for about 30 seconds until fragrant. Pour in the lemon juice and chicken broth, scraping any browned bits from the bottom of the skillet for flavor. Bring the mixture to a simmer and cook for 3-4 minutes to reduce slightly.

Finishing the Sauce

Lower the heat and stir in the heavy cream and butter until the sauce is smooth and creamy. Add the lemon zest and stir well. Taste the sauce and adjust with additional salt or lemon juice if needed.

Combining Chicken and Sauce

Return the cooked chicken to the skillet, spooning the sauce over the top. Simmer for another 2-3 minutes to allow the flavors to meld and heat the chicken through. Garnish with chopped parsley for a fresh touch.

4. Tips to Perfect Your Lemon Chicken with Rich Lemon Butter Sauce

  • Use fresh lemon juice for the best flavor.
  • Ensure the chicken is pounded to an even thickness for uniform cooking.
  • Let the sauce simmer gently; boiling may cause it to break or become greasy.

5. Storage and Reheating

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Reheat gently on the stovetop over low heat, stirring occasionally. You can also freeze the cooked chicken and sauce for longer storage but note that the texture of the sauce may slightly change upon thawing.

7. FAQ: Your Questions About Lemon Chicken Answered

Can I substitute chicken breasts with thighs?

Yes! Skinless, boneless chicken thighs can be used for a juicier, more flavorful dish. Adjust cooking time accordingly, as thighs may need an extra 2-3 minutes.

Is this lemon chicken recipe suitable for keto or low-carb diets?

Absolutely. This recipe is naturally low in carbs, especially if you omit any added starches or serve it with low-carb side dishes like steamed greens or cauliflower rice.

How long does it take to prepare this dish?

Overall, expect about 30 minutes from start to finish, making it an excellent choice for a quick delicious dinner.

Lemon Chicken with Rich Lemon Butter Sauce

5 Stars 4 Stars 3 Stars 2 Stars 1 Star

No reviews

A flavorful and tender lemon chicken cooked to perfection, topped with a tangy lemon butter sauce that adds richness and zest. Ideal for a quick weeknight dinner or a special meal.

  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 boneless chicken breasts
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• Salt and black pepper to taste
  • 1/4 cup all-purpose flour
  • 3 tablespoons butter
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1/4 cup fresh lemon juice
  • 1 teaspoon lemon zest
  • 1/4 cup chicken broth
  •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)

Instructions

  1. Season the chicken breasts with salt and pepper. Lightly dredge them in flour.
  2.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Cook chicken until golden and cooked through, about 6-7 minutes per side. Remove and set aside.
  3. In the same skillet, add butter and garlic; sauté until fragrant.
  4. Add lemon juice, lemon zest, and chicken broth. Bring to a simmer and cook for 2-3 minutes.
  5. Return the chicken to the skillet, spoon sauce over, and cook for another 2 minutes to coat.
  6. Garnish with chopped parsley and serve hot with your favorite sides.

Notes

  • Adjust lemon juice for more tang if desired.
  • You can substitute chicken thighs for breasts for juicier results.
  • Serve with rice or steamed vegetables for a complete meal.
